U-Boat info plate
Hi
Wanted to share this small but awesome piece of history, an info plate from an U-Boat warning that 'the fan may only be turned off temporarily during silent running'. I speculate that it might be referring to one of the fans used for cooling the electric motors but any additional info about where in the boat it might have been located would be appreciated. There's a decent chance that it belonged to U-573 (G7 / S-01 in Spanish service).

Hello,
I cannot imagine how many plates like this would have been mounted inside a U-boot with all of the working components of a submarine.
I would agree with you that this refers to the auxiliary electric motors. Schleichfahrt was creeping speed and relied on the electric motors to propel the sub while producing the least amount of noise. Electric motors of that size and advanced nature found during the war would have certainly burnt up if the ventilators were switched off. I would guess it was mounted to the auxiliary switchboard that controlled the batteries and electric motors. All of which was placed forward to the diesel engines as electric motors worked through the diesel engines to the propellers via a clutch and drive shaft.
